After AICC president Mallikarjun Kharge sternly warned Congress leaders to "shut up and discharge the responsibilities assigned to them", the public airing of views on internal issues has stopped.

- Ramu Patil Assistant Resident Editor

It could be a temporary period of calm before the leadership issues resurface. For now, Kharge's diktat stopped the ruling party from drifting towards chaos and impacting the administration.

On the other hand, there seems to be no end to the BJP's internal squabbles. Implosions continue to rock the party despite its leadership's efforts to end it.

In Karnataka—which the BJP considers its gateway to the South—the party is facing a series of crises, with too many fissures. After its legislators Basangouda Patil Yatnal, Ramesh Jarkiholi and team raised a banner of revolt against the state leadership headed by BY Vijayendra, a public spat between close friends-turned-foes B Sriramulu and Gali Janardhan Reddy exposed the vulnerabilities within the party. The party's top guns from Ballari went ballistic, making serious accusations against each other, prompting BJP national president JP Nadda's attempts to assuage Ramulu.
